The Importance of Business Listings Sites in the Modern UK Economy
The UK market is incredibly competitive. For a small or medium-sized enterprise (SME), standing out in search engine results pages (SERPs) requires more than just a website. It requires a network of citations. Using high-quality business listings sites ensures that your NAP (Name, Address, Phone Number) data is consistent across the web, which is a critical ranking factor for Google.
When you list your business on a free business database directory, you aren't just putting your name in a list. You are creating a backlink, a point of discovery, and a platform for feedback. Modern business listings sites act as a bridge between the customer's intent and your service. If someone searches for "best accountants near me," Google pulls data from these directories to populate the "Local Pack."
Furthermore, these platforms provide an essential service: local seo listings uk. By appearing on multiple trusted sites, you build "domain authority" by association. This tells search engines that your business is legitimate and active. The Benefits of Local SEO and Citations
Your strategy for local seo citations uk should be diversified. Having your business name mentioned on various business listings sites builds a "web of trust." Each citation acts as a vote of confidence for your brand. When you submit website uk directory links to your own site, you are improving your backlink profile, which is essential for climbing the search rankings.
Consider the impact of local seo directory uk entries on your map rankings. Google compares the data on your website with the data on business listings sites. If they match, Google feels confident in showing your business to local searchers. Mastering the Art of Online Reputation Management
Once you've listed on several business listings sites, the work doesn't stop. You must actively engage. Responding to customer feedback uk companies—both positive and negative—shows that you care. It turns a free review company directory into a customer service channel.
Even a negative review is an opportunity. If a customer complains on a uk company reviews site, and you respond professionally and solve the issue, prospective customers see that you are accountable. This often builds more trust than a profile with 100% perfect, yet suspiciously similar, reviews.

What is the difference between a citation and a backlink?
A citation is a mention of your business NAP on business listings sites. A backlink is a clickable link to your site. Most good directories provide both, which is great for your local seo citations uk strategy.
